What is a Hycross Hybrid and how does it work?

A Hycross Hybrid is a type of vehicle that combines a conventional internal combustion engine with an electric motor and a battery pack. This allows the vehicle to operate in different modes, such as running solely on electric power, using the engine to generate electricity, or combining both power sources for improved performance. The Hycross Hybrid system is designed to optimize fuel efficiency, reduce emissions, and provide a smoother driving experience. By switching between these modes, the vehicle can achieve better fuel economy, especially in city driving or low-speed conditions.

The Hycross Hybrid system consists of several key components, including the engine, electric motor, battery pack, and power control unit. The engine is typically a smaller, more efficient unit that provides primary power, while the electric motor assists during acceleration and braking. The battery pack stores excess energy generated by the engine or through regenerative braking, which is then used to power the electric motor. The power control unit manages the flow of energy between the different components, ensuring seamless transitions between modes and optimizing overall system performance. This sophisticated technology enables the Hycross Hybrid to achieve improved fuel efficiency, lower emissions, and enhanced driving dynamics.

What are the drawbacks of owning a Hycross Hybrid vehicle?

While Hycross Hybrids offer many benefits, there are also some drawbacks to consider. One of the main disadvantages is the higher upfront cost, as these vehicles are often more expensive than their conventional counterparts. Additionally, the battery pack and other hybrid components can be complex and costly to replace if they fail. Some drivers may also experience a learning curve when adapting to the unique characteristics of a Hycross Hybrid, such as the feeling of the electric motor assisting during acceleration. Furthermore, the fuel efficiency advantages of Hycross Hybrids may be reduced in certain driving conditions, such as high-speed highway driving or towing.
